Output 8759e3bfbbb5ac343e634701e5f758b67b26aae20284baff8d2462e74e9a470d:2

value
2083400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9700eb1d705e6ae80c34979160e596c9b8dede02 OP_EQUAL
address
3FTT4Kge9Y9pkXtYhZ3EQjHWNJ29rHse4F
transaction
8759e3bfbbb5ac343e634701e5f758b67b26aae20284baff8d2462e74e9a470d
confirmations
359549
spent
true